How to Clean a Waffle Iron? Follow the Steps:
Things You Will Need Before Cleaning the Waffle iron:
The essential accessories to aid are:
- A soft brush or paper towels.
- Microfiber cloth. You could also use rags.
- Tongs with silicone or plastic cap. (Optional accessory)
- Liquid dish soap.
- Hydrogen peroxide. (Available at Pharmacies)
- Baking Soda and,
- Toothpicks.
All these accessories are easily available in kitchens except Hydrogen peroxide. You could find this chemical easily from a nearby pharmacy.
10 Easy Steps to Clean a Waffle Maker:
1. Unplug the Electric Waffle Maker:
Never start the cleaning process when the appliance is plugged in. Unplug the waffle maker and allow it to cool down completely.
2. Removing Loose Crumbs:
Loose crumbs are prominent when you are done with cooking waffles. To remove them instantly, use paper towels or a used brush.
Note that you must never use any abrasive metal to remove loose crumbs. It could end up damaging the non-stick surface of the plates.
3. Absorb Excess of Oil:
Use paper towels yet again to absorb excess oil from the grates. To reach the corners of cooking grates, make sure that you fold the paper towel accordingly.
When done, use a dry paper towel to remove any leftover oil residue perfectly.
4. Preparing the Cleaning Cloth:
Now would be the time to clean the waffle maker extensively. For that, you need to prepare the cloth which you intend to use on the grates.
I suggest using a rag with a small texture or a microfiber cloth as such fabric has better penetrating power.
Simply wet the cloth a little bit and pour some amount of liquid dish soap on it. You can use your regular dish soap for this purpose. No need to spend money on anything expensive.
5. Wiping down the Inside of Waffle Maker:
The soapy cloth is now ready to wipe the inside of the waffle grid. Try to wipe every nook and corner of the appliance. Make sure that there isn’t any oil or grease left.
Take help from the tongs and use them to insert the rag in deep areas. Take your time as the dirt won’t go that easily.
6. For Removing Burnt Food:
To remove burnt food from the waffle makers, you’ll need the services of hydrogen peroxide and baking soda.
Mix baking soda in hydrogen peroxide in a small bowl and leave it be for at least 5 minutes.
7. Applying Paste:
When ready, apply paste on the grates of the waffle maker. Keep in mind that it must reach the burnt areas.
After applying the paste, leave the waffle machine for a couple of hours. If the stinks are too much stubborn, then give at least 3 to 4 hours to paste for absorbing the burnt residue.
8. Clean the Paste Thoroughly:
Whenever the paste starts getting brown, it would mean that the burnt residue is getting dissolved in it.
After this, take a clean wet cloth and thoroughly clean the grates and side areas of waffle iron.
Continue this process until the burnt food is removed from the grates completely.
9. Detailing:
This is where you’d need a toothpick or a narrow wood stick. Scrape all the nooks and corners of your Belgian waffle maker to remove any batter or crumb residue.
When done, take a soapy rag and wipe out the exterior of the waffle maker thoroughly. Don’t leave any area uncovered.
10. Drying:
The last step involves drying the waffle maker thoroughly. For this purpose, take a clean, soft, and dry microfiber cloth and rub it on all areas of the waffle maker.
That’s how one can clean a dirty, grimy, and greasy waffle maker without any complex effort.
Side Notes:
First off, try to get a waffle maker with detachable cooking grates. This way, the cleaning process becomes quite easy.
In this context, if the cooking grates are detachable, simply soak them in soapy water, and wash them thoroughly.
Using cooking spray is not a good idea while making waffles. The buildup these sprays make is not easy to clean.

Bonus Tips to Maintain Your Waffle Machine:
I am a NERD when it comes to maintaining different kitchen appliances.
That said, some of the tips I’d want to give as a bonus to maintain a waffle maker are:
1. First things first, never ignore the waffle machine when you are done making waffles with it. Clean it as soon as you get free time and don’t leave it on tomorrow.
2. Purchase a waffle maker with detachable grates if possible. This way, the cleaning is hassle-free.
3. Critically analyze the instructions manual offered by manufacturer to avoid any damage while cleaning.
4. DO NOT use abrasive or sharp metals to clean the cooking grates of a waffle maker. You’ll end up removing the non-stick coating of the appliance.
5. If the waffles are already getting stuck on the cooking grates, then it’s better to use wax paper between the plates. Use it before pouring the batter to avoid any mess.
6. Handle your electric waffle maker with great care. Make sure that the water doesn’t reach the electric parts while you are cleaning it.
7. Use your appliance for making simple waffles only. Don’t try any new recipe if you want to enhance the lifespan of your waffle maker.
8. It’s better to invest in a prestigious waffle maker brand such as Cuisinart or Breville rather than going for cheap waffle irons.
9. Remove dust from the waffle maker if you are using it after a long time.
10. All in all, don’t keep the waffle maker idle for too long. Try preparing delicious and tasty waffles every once in a while.
